From the founder
Why I built this
After years as a licensed clinical social worker, I kept running into the same problem. A client would ask, "Is there a group for this?" and I would spend the next hour digging through bookmarks, old emails, and scattered flyers trying to find something that fit. If it was that hard for me, I knew it was nearly impossible for the people who actually needed help.
My Therapy Groups started as a simple idea. What if there was one trusted place where anyone could find a support group, a therapy group, or a community of people walking the same road? Not a directory stuffed with ads, and not a list that hadn't been updated in three years. A real home for real groups, free to the providers who run them.
Every group you see here exists because someone believed that healing happens in community. My hope is that this site makes it a little easier for you to find yours.
Stephanie Smith, LCSW
Founder, My Therapy Groups
